Hertz Offers Discounts and Promotions to Boost Demand for Electric Vehicle Rentals

Introduction

Hertz, one of the largest rental car companies in the world, is making bold moves to encourage renters to choose electric vehicles (EVs) from its fleet. With a massive investment in EVs, Hertz aims to have over 340,000 EVs by 2027, including vehicles from Tesla, Polestar, and GM. In an effort to promote the adoption of EVs, Hertz is offering discounted prices and free rental days for customers who choose to rent an EV for at least two days by September 6. Additionally, Hertz is donating EVs to educational institutions to provide students with hands-on experience with the technology.

The Hertz Electric Vehicle Fleet

Hertz has taken a significant step towards electrification by announcing plans to have more than 50,000 EVs in its fleet, accounting for about 10% of its total fleet. The company’s commitment to EVs is evident in its recent press announcements, which highlight plans for large-scale EV deployments in cities like Orlando, Houston, Denver, and Atlanta. Hertz has also collaborated with city planners to determine optimal locations for charging infrastructure through its Charging Opportunity Index.

Challenges and Controversies

While Hertz‘s push for EVs has garnered praise, it has also faced criticism. One incident involved a writer who received an all-electric Chevy Bolt as a “manager’s special” without prior notice, leading to confusion and inconvenience due to the writer’s lack of familiarity with the charging process. To address such issues, Hertz has updated its rental website to disclose that the manager’s special car might be electric.

Promotions and Discounts

To encourage renters to choose EVs, Hertz is offering various promotions and discounts. Renters who choose an EV for at least two days by September 6 will receive a free rental day. In addition, Hertz is providing a separate 30% discount on EV rentals until the end of August. These deals are intended to entice customers to consider renting an EV and experience its benefits firsthand.

The Importance of Education and Awareness

Hertz recognizes the importance of educating renters about EVs and their features. Customers who request an EV will receive an emailed link to an online EV guide, providing them with essential information about EVs and their operation. Hertz is also updating the keychains of its EVs to include a QR code that links to the guide, making it easily accessible during the rental period.

A Growing Market for EV Rentals

While Hertz is leading the way with its substantial investment in EVs, other rental car companies, including Avis and Enterprise, also offer EV rentals, although on a smaller scale. The market for EV rentals is expected to grow as more people become interested in sustainable transportation options. Hertz‘s discounts and promotions could play a crucial role in attracting customers and driving the adoption of EVs.
